Overview

Strategic context

India now hosts over 40% of the world's ER&D centers, with mandates spanning automotive, semiconductor, aerospace, medtech and industrial IoT.

The shift from staff augmentation to full product ownership is structural — India ER&D centers increasingly own architecture, roadmap and global P&L responsibility.

Engineering centers are no longer cost centers; they are the IP creation engine of the parent enterprise.

FAQ

Frequently asked

Which sectors drive ER&D growth in India?+

Automotive, semicon, aerospace, medtech, and industrial IoT lead ER&D expansion.

How are engineering centers measured today?+

Patents, platform ownership, time-to-launch and global P&L — not seat count.
